Estimation models for the preliminary design of electromechanical actuators
This paper presents estimation models for the model-based preliminary design of electro-mechanical actuators. Models are developed to generate all the parameters required by a multi-objective design, from a limited number of input parameters. متن کاملDynamic Electromechanical Coupling of Piezoelectric Bending Actuators
Abstract: Electromechanical coupling defines the ratio of electrical and mechanical energy exchanged during a flexure cycle of a piezoelectric actuator. متن کاملTSets Intelligent Controller for Electromechanical Positioning Actuators
A cognitive intelligent approach to the control of an electromechanical positioning actuator using Tendentious Vague Sets (TSets) is presented. The electromechanical positioning actuator prototype discussed is essentially a position control system whose constitutive elements are a PC based control unit, a Direct Torque Control (DTC) inverter and an induction motor.
